Transaction

d99ee00330af3ffe0d7ef85fbed97e6aff08dc8f72c8f2a61fd9de23b65224d8
507,718 confirmations
Timestamp
1474011124
Block430,048
Fee110,760 sats
Fee rate20.5 sats/vB
view on mempool.space

Inputs & Outputs

Inputs